Re: Diesel knock sensors ever posible? ALL

You also need to remember that it is only in the last 10 years or so that diesel technology has advanced since probably 1930. Listen to a new highway tractor, and watch the stacks compared to ten years ago. No smoke, quiet, powerful, economical- all due to the electronic controls added. The new GM pickup diesel uses "common rail" injectors, which I presume means electronic, and it would not surprise me if they use a knock sensor tuned to specific resonances- even a gas engine must use a specific knock sensor based on engine type, sensor location,etc.
